Responsibilities
- Conduct patient assessments using the nursing process and develop an individualized plan of care with patient and caregiver involvement.
- Serve as Case Manager for assigned patients, actively managing caseload and visit times in line with agency productivity standards.
- Implement medical plan of care, nursing interventions, and procedures to ensure safe, effective, quality care; maintain infection control standards throughout the plan of care.
- Maintain up-to-date, accurate documentation (including OASIS where applicable), annotations on visit notes, and timely completion of required forms.
- Collaborate with LPNs and other disciplines to ensure the plan of care is followed; communicate identified inter-disciplinary needs to relevant team members; provide patient and caregiver education.
- Monitor and document patient responses to care, evaluate outcomes, and communicate recommendations to optimize ongoing quality of care.
